人妻系列无码专区av在线,国内精品久久久久久婷婷,久草视频在线播放,精品国产线拍大陆久久尤物

當(dāng)前位置:首頁 > 開發(fā)語言 > 正文

c語言函數(shù)返回值類型由什么決定?如何選擇?

c語言函數(shù)返回值類型由什么決定?如何選擇?

函數(shù)返回值的類型由什么來決定 c語言規(guī)定,函數(shù)返回值的類型是由函數(shù)首部定義的類型決定。函數(shù)返回值應(yīng)與首部定義的類型一致,如若不一致,則自動將返回值轉(zhuǎn)換為函數(shù)首部定義的類...

函數(shù)返回值的類型由什么來決定

c語言規(guī)定,函數(shù)返回值的類型是由函數(shù)首部定義的類型決定。函數(shù)返回值應(yīng)與首部定義的類型一致,如若不一致,則自動將返回值轉(zhuǎn)換為函數(shù)首部定義的類型。沒有定義類型時默認(rèn)為int型。也就是說你的函數(shù)是什么類型,返回值就是什么類型。

函數(shù)返回值類型由函數(shù)首部定義的類型決定。函數(shù)返回值應(yīng)與首部定義的類型一致,如若不一致,則自動將返回值轉(zhuǎn)換為函數(shù)首部定義的類型。沒有定義類型時默認(rèn)為int型。也就是說你的函數(shù)是什么類型,返回值就是什么類型。函數(shù),數(shù)學(xué)術(shù)語。

【答】:A 在c語言中,函數(shù)返回的類型最終取決于函數(shù)定義時在函數(shù)首部所說明的函數(shù)類型,與調(diào)用函數(shù)時主調(diào)函數(shù)所傳遞的實(shí)參類型和函數(shù)定義時形參的類型無關(guān),而return語句表達(dá)式的值將轉(zhuǎn)換為函數(shù)定義時在函數(shù)首部所說明的函數(shù)類型返回。

c語言中函數(shù)返回值的類型由什么決定?

是由你定義函數(shù)時所定義的函數(shù)的類型決定的。也就是說函數(shù)是什么類型,返回值就是什么類型。比如:函數(shù)定義 int fun(int a,char b)。返回值就是整型。函數(shù)定義 int *fun(int a)。返回值就是基類型為整型的指針。函數(shù)定義 void fun(int a)。無返回值。

在c語言中,函數(shù)返回的類型最終取決于函數(shù)定義時在函數(shù)首部所說明的函數(shù)類型,與調(diào)用函數(shù)時主調(diào)函數(shù)所傳遞的實(shí)參類型和函數(shù)定義時形參的類型無關(guān),而return語句表達(dá)式的值將轉(zhuǎn)換為函數(shù)定義時在函數(shù)首部所說明的函數(shù)類型返回。

決定C語言中函數(shù)返回值類型的是定義函數(shù)時在函數(shù)首部所指定的類型。在C語言中,一個標(biāo)準(zhǔn)的函數(shù)定義語句塊必須包含函數(shù)返回值的類型標(biāo)識符、函數(shù)名、形參類型及數(shù)量、函數(shù)體、返回值表達(dá)式。如果函數(shù)返回值類型為 void (即無返回值)。

c語言規(guī)定,函數(shù)返回值的類型是由函數(shù)首部定義的類型決定。函數(shù)返回值應(yīng)與首部定義的類型一致,如若不一致,則自動將返回值轉(zhuǎn)換為函數(shù)首部定義的類型。沒有定義類型時默認(rèn)為int型。也就是說你的函數(shù)是什么類型,返回值就是什么類型。

函數(shù)返回類型是你定義函數(shù)時自己決定的,默認(rèn)為int型 C語言函數(shù)格式為: 類型名 函數(shù)名(形參1,形參2……)類型名就決定了返回類型,如果沒有明確寫出返回類型的話,默認(rèn)為int類型。void是空類型, void必須要明確寫出來才可以,指的是函數(shù)不提供返回值,不是默認(rèn)的。

返回值的類型由return后面的參數(shù)確定;Return語句可以用來返變量或指針中的值,也可以用來返回0,表示返回為空,返回一個代數(shù)值,通常在子函數(shù)zd的末尾。return 表示把程序流程從被調(diào)函數(shù)轉(zhuǎn)向主調(diào)函數(shù)并把表達(dá)式的值帶回主調(diào)函數(shù),實(shí)現(xiàn)函數(shù)值的返回,返回時可附帶一個返回值,由return后面的參數(shù)指定。